Lab Assistant (Student Worker)

Location: Post University Main Campus, MacDermid Hall
Supervisor: Laura Bailey, Associate Program Chair of Life and Physical Sciences & Lab Manager
Hours: Approximately 10 hours per week
Pay: Minimum Wage
Duration: Academic Year 2026-2027 (year-round opportunity)

About the Role

As a Lab Assistant, you'll help support the daily operations of the Life and Physical Sciences Department (LPSD). This is a great opportunity to gain hands-on experience working in a laboratory environment while supporting faculty, instructors, and fellow students.

What You'll Do

  • Assist faculty and lab instructors with preparing materials and setting up laboratory and field activities
  • Clean and organize laboratory equipment, glassware, and workspaces
  • Help maintain an efficient and safe laboratory environment
  • Complete other department-related tasks as assigned

Qualifications

To be successful in this role, you should:

  • Have completed at least one high school laboratory science course
  • Be currently enrolled in a college laboratory science course (completion of a college lab course is preferred)
  • Be reliable, responsible, and able to work independently
  • Be comfortable handling laboratory glassware and equipment
  • Communicate effectively with faculty, staff, and fellow student assistants
  • Preferably be majoring in a laboratory science program at Post University (Biology minors are also encouraged to apply)

What You'll Gain

This position offers valuable hands-on experience in laboratory operations, including:

  • Laboratory and field experiment setup
  • Equipment preparation and use
  • Laboratory safety practices and procedures
  • Professional skills in organization, teamwork, and communication

This opportunity is open to Post University students only.
